Ingredients
Scale
Main Ingredients:
- 500g ground beef
- 400g spaghetti
- 400g canned tomatoes
Cheese:
- 200g mozzarella cheese, shredded
- 100g parmesan cheese, grated
Herbs and Seasonings:
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- 1 onion, diced
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 teaspoon dried oregano
- 1 salt to taste
- 1 pepper to taste
Instructions
- Heat your oven to 350°F (180°C) and prepare a 9×13-inch baking dish.
- Boil 400g spaghetti in salted water for 8-10 minutes until al dente. Drain completely.
- Warm 2 tablespoons ol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at.
- Sauté 1 diced onion and 2 minced garlic cloves for 3-4 minutes until translucent.
- Add 500g ground beef to the skillet, breaking it into small pieces. Cook 6-7 minutes until no pink remains.
- Pour 400g canned tomatoes into the beef. Sprinkle 1 teaspoon dried oregano, salt, and pepper. Simmer 10 minutes.
- Mix cooked spaghetti with meat sauce until thoroughly combined.
- Transfer spaghetti mixture to the baking dish, spreading evenly.
- Scatter 200g shredded mozzarella and 100g grated parmesan cheese across the top.
- Bake 25-30 minutes until cheese melts and turns golden brown.
- Remove from oven and rest 5 minutes before serving to allow flavors to settle.
Notes
- Use freshly grated parmesan for richer flavor and better melting texture.
- Keep the dish covered with foil for the first 15 minutes of baking to prevent cheese from burning.
- Let the spaghetti rest after cooking to help it absorb sauce more effectively.
- For a gluten-free version, swap traditional spaghetti with zucchini noodles or gluten-free pasta.
